Kang Dabao left the shopkeeper surnamed Ye and returned to Chongming Tower. He asked Zhou Xinran to settle a team of soldiers first, and then took her back to the sect.
Sitting in the sect's meeting hall, after all the fellow disciples and disciples were seated, Sect Leader Kang finally spoke.
"The provincial court has sent a letter asking me to lead a team to meet up with Sima Fei in Wang County to suppress the bandits. With such a big commotion, both sides will probably have to gather hundreds of cultivators to fight, which will most likely involve foundation building." Kang Dabao paused here and looked around. Not to mention his fellow disciples and disciples, even the old cultivator Ji Wuwu showed concern. He couldn't help but feel relieved.
"It's a dangerous journey, and I'm afraid it's hard to be safe. There are always some things to be explained first." The head of the Kang family said in a serious tone, but Jiang Qing, who had done the attack, suddenly stood up and said, "Brother, let me go with you. As long as I still have the sword in my hand, no one can hurt you."
Upon hearing this, Master Kang's face seemed to show some kindness. After all, it was the junior brother who grew up in the cargo rack on his shoulders. Now the junior brother is Zhou Yixiu.
Kang Dabao felt warm in his heart, but he still scolded, "You are bragging. I have already said that this matter involves building a foundation, how can you not be injured? If you go with me, I will be serving as an official for nothing."
Jiang Qing's face turned pale when he heard this. He clenched his teeth, lowered his head and said no more.
"I'm not bringing anyone with me this time, so you just stay at home and take care of the house." Kang Dabao raised his hand and suppressed Yuan Jin who had just stood up to say something.
"Well, there is no point in talking any more. I called you here because I have some things to arrange. Junior Brother Zhou, please estimate the revenue of Chongming Building first."
"In reply to the headmaster, in the past three months, Chongming Tower has made a profit of 11 spirit stones from the sale of elixirs, 8 spirit stones from the sale of magic tools, and 42 spirit stones from the operation of the wine shop and accommodation. Based on this estimate, it is expected that the final profit for the whole year will be around 240 spirit stones."
"The head master previously exempted the rent for each store in Chongming Market for four years. Now, we can share the stall fees of the independent cultivators with the four stores. We can earn about 400 spirit stones a year. Excluding the 300 spirit stones for maintaining the market formation, we can still get about 70 spirit stones every year."
Zhou Xinran received the order, and a calm and serene look appeared on his originally plain face. He stood up from his seat and answered.
Kang Dabao nodded with satisfaction. After nearly a year of operation and the hard work of the pretty steward Zhou Xinran, Chongming Building finally seemed to be getting on the right track.
Excluding the dividends given to Pei Yi and Yuan Jin, and the salaries of the two chefs, Chongming Xiaolou can still make a stable profit of two to three hundred spirit stones a year, which is much better than the situation when it first opened.
"Junior Brother Zhou, please tell me about the situation of the spiritual field." Kang Dabao turned and looked at Zhou Yixiu.
"Last season, Rongquan planted a sparse amount of red spiritual grain based on my experience, but it didn't grow well. We only harvested eight hu and one dou of red spiritual grain from the twenty-one mu first-grade low-quality spiritual field. Not only did we earn almost no spiritual stones after deducting the expenses of spiritual fertilizer and seeds, but we also reduced the fertility of the spiritual field. This means that we won't be able to plant spiritual grain next year and we need to leave the field fallow."
"But I read the Nine Theories on Spiritual Plants left by the seniors in the sect. It said that in this case, you can plant some white alfalfa. Not only can it produce a little, but it can also increase the fertility of the spiritual field more than planting yellow sprout beans. I roughly calculated that according to this method, you can earn about 30 spiritual stones with the output of white alfalfa in one season."
"We can plant spiritual grains next year. Our spiritual fields are all newly opened, and their fertility is still a lot poor. We may not be able to grow red spiritual grains well. Junior brother prefers to plant brown grains. If all goes well, we can probably earn about 90 spiritual stones a year. We will continue to cultivate according to the crop rotation method every year, planting white alfalfa and brown grains in turn. After seven or eight years, when the fertility of the spiritual fields has improved, we can try to plant red spiritual grains and some low-level spiritual medicines. After another 20 to 30 years of cultivating the spiritual fields, Junior brother can try to upgrade some of the spiritual fields to first-class medium-quality ones."
"That locust tree is almost fully recovered. The female cultivator from the Lu family came to see it earlier. Next year, her black spirit bees will be able to collect honey. We will make a net profit of 120 to 160 spirit stones from the spirit honey alone. The locust flowers will also be produced, which will make about 80 to 100 spirit stones."
Zhou Yixiu was indeed a very good farmer. He had all the information about spiritual plants in his head. He answered Kang Dabao's questions in an orderly manner and his statements were straightforward. Even a complete layman who knew nothing about spiritual plants could understand him clearly.
"Based on the minimum calculation, Junior Brother Zhou's spiritual plants can earn about 250 spiritual stones for the sect each year. At most, it will be more than 350. Adding the 310 from Chongming Market, that means there will be at least 560 spiritual stones brought in each year." Kang Dabao closed his eyes and calculated, feeling delighted.
Whether or not there is a qualified master of farming can have a great impact on the development of the sect.
"Thank you for your hard work, Junior Brother Zhou." Master Kang praised from the bottom of his heart.
Zhou Yixiu even said he dared not, these days in Chongming Sect were indeed rare days in his years of cultivation where he could practice with peace of mind. He really had a sincere gratitude towards Kang Dabao in his heart.
"If I had come here earlier, I wouldn't be still at the fifth level of Qi training, with no hope of building a foundation." Zhou Yixiu sighed in his heart and looked at Kang Dabao with some worry in his eyes. If something happened to the head brother, he didn't know whether the current situation that he had worked so hard to build could be maintained.
"Junior Brother Yuan, you have been in charge of the sect's expenses these days, so tell us about it." Kang Dabao called Yuan Jin out again. In fact, he had always been doing this matter with Yuan Jin, so he knew most of it. However, since Chongming Sect had rarely held such a serious meeting today, he still needed to talk about it.
"There are not many expenditure items in the sect nowadays. The biggest part is still the annual salary and job allowance of each disciple." Yuan Jin paused, took out the jade slip he carried with him, and read it: "Our sect now has one late-stage disciple, with an annual salary of 40 yuan; four middle-stage disciples, each with an annual salary of 20 yuan, a total of 80 yuan; six early-stage disciples (Zhou Xinran, Han Yundao, Duan Anle, Kang Rongquan, Pei Que, Jin Shilun), each with an annual salary of 10 yuan, a total of 60 yuan; and two disciples who have not yet entered the Tao (Mo'er and Zhang Le), have not received annual salaries.
"At the same time, disciples who have not reached the age of dancing elephants (fifteen years old) will receive a subsidy of five spirit stones every year, totaling twenty spirit stones. The total annual salary is two hundred spirit stones."
"In addition to the annual salary, each disciple who holds a position will receive an allowance. The head of the sect receives 100 spirit stones a year; the deacon who teaches skills receives 20 spirit stones a year, the deacon who refines pills receives 20 spirit stones a year, the deacon who refines weapons receives 20 spirit stones a year, the deacon who manages spirit plants receives 20 spirit stones a year, the disciple who manages spirit plants receives 5 spirit stones a year, the disciple who manages the market receives 5 spirit stones a year, the disciple who manages the animal garden receives 5 spirit stones a year, and the disciple who is a chef receives 5 spirit stones a year. The total amount of the position allowance is 200 spirit stones."
"Early-stage disciples need to buy two bottles of Qi Condensation Pills every year, which only includes the raw materials, and costs two spirit stones. Mid-stage disciples need to buy one bottle of Qi Refining Powder every year, which costs twelve spirit stones. Late-stage disciples need to pay for their own elixirs, and an additional eighteen spirit stones are allocated. The total cost of elixirs is seventy-eight spirit stones."
"With this, plus the sixty spirit stones that need to be paid to the Pingrong County Government every year, our sect's annual fixed expenditure is five hundred and thirty-eight spirit stones."
Kang Dabao sighed after hearing this. Chong Mingzong was indeed earning a lot now, but his expenses were also not small.
The person primarily responsible for this situation is naturally Sect Leader Kang. The annual salary he offers to his disciples is one-third higher than that of long-established large sects like Cao Wu Sect, and is almost as high as that of Chong Ming Sect during its heyday.
But now, after some planning by Sect Leader Kang, the areas where large amounts of spirit stones were needed have been almost all spent. Instead of hoarding the earned spirit stones, it would be more cost-effective to distribute them as soon as possible to enhance the strength of the disciples.
Besides, the actual expenses are not that big. For example, Kang Dabao, the sect does not have enough spirit stones now, and he has never received the full 100-yuan allowance for the head of the sect.
As for Jiang Qing's Seven Lights Heart-Severing Sword, he explicitly stated that he would pay the sect back with his own spirit stones. He had picked up quite a few storage bags over the years, and it would be easy to pay it back by selling the odds and ends;
As for the hundreds of spirit stones that Yuan Jin had spent to get away from Master Qi, he also said that he would suspend his annual salary until he paid it off.
In this way, the Chongming Sect only needs to operate normally every year, and after distributing generous spiritual supplies to the disciples, there will still be more than one hundred or nearly two hundred spirit stones left. After saving for five or six years, it will be able to easily buy a top-level magic weapon similar to the Seven Stars Heart-Severing Sword.
This can be considered quite good among the spiritual forces in Pingrong County.
After decades of hard work, Kang Dabao finally helped Chongming Sect get rid of the poverty-stricken days of the past. After counting all this, he couldn't help but feel a little emotional. "Good." Thousands of words were left in his heart, and in the end, only the word "good" came out of Kang Dabao's mouth.
"Youngsters, please stand up and let me take another look." Master Kang calmed down his somewhat excited mood.
As the eldest senior brother of the next generation, Han Yundao, with red eyes, led a group of younger generations to the center of the hall.
"My dear son, practice hard and let me see the day when my Chongming Sect will no longer be controlled by others."
"Great uncle." The younger generations all wiped their tears. Kang Rongquan cried the most sadly, and his clothes were wet.
"I am about to go on a long journey, and I should not say discouraging words. However, this battle involves building a foundation, and I may not be able to come back safely. It would be more appropriate to decide on the position of the next headmaster first." Kang Dabao turned his gaze to his fellow disciples.
"Junior Brother Yuan."
"Yuan Jin is here."
"If I really can't come back, you just take on the role of the headmaster." Kang Dabao sighed, and as soon as he said this, the air in the hall almost froze.
Kang Dabao carefully glanced at the expressions of his fellow apprentices. They all had frowns and were very anxious, but there were some differences in the details.
Zhou Yixiu's face was filled with sorrow, Jiang Qing's face was mixed with anxiety and hope, and Yuan Jin's face was 99% fear mixed with 10% joy.
After Pei Yi's hope, fear and sorrow, there was an unconcealable flash of loss in his eyes.
To be fair, when it comes to the position of the leader of the Chongming Sect, regardless of the aspects of cultivation, qualifications, and abilities, Pei Yi should be much stronger than his junior brother Yuan Jin. If he were to be the leader, he would be more suitable.
But Kang Dabao hesitated for a long time, and still chose Yuan Jin as the head.
Perhaps this is also the reason why the uncles chose to move out of Chongming Sect and leave in anger after the old man made the decision that year.
However, power is tempting, and human nature is such that practitioners are not immortals after all, and it is still difficult for them to escape from the mundane world.
At that time, the master had no son, and his only daughter was a useless girl. She was not much younger than Kang Dabao, but her cultivation was even worse than Kang Dabao's.
Because of some things that were difficult to talk about, she left home early and never returned. Plus, she was a woman, so naturally she couldn't be the head of the sect.
However, there wasn't even a single immortal with spiritual roots among the He family at that time, so it was naturally impossible for this position to be passed down to the He family members in a simple way.
The old man was selfish at the time and passed the position to his eldest disciple instead of choosing the young and strong Uncle Li and others.
It is not known whether he had thought about it at the time, but this decision would cause the Chongming Sect, which he had managed to build up with great difficulty and had just shown some signs of revival, to completely fall apart.
Today, I am also selfish and unwilling to pass the position of the head of the sect to Uncle Li's line, which also hurts Pei Yi's heart.
But the Chongming Sect of today was almost entirely created by himself, so he will not repeat the same mistakes as before.
"Huh, the position that Master passed on to me should be passed on to Master's disciples. I should be able to do it well." Master Kang looked at Yuan Jin with some worry.
"Junior Brother Pei." Kang Dabao looked at Pei Yi again.
"Pei Yi is here." Pei Yi was a little dazed. When he heard Kang Dabao calling him, he was stunned for a moment before he stood up.
"Junior brother Song Cai Panmian, and a man of great talent, will be promoted to the position of elder to pass on the skills from today onwards."
"Junior brother thanks the headmaster." Pei Yi knew that this was Kang Dabao's consolation to him, and he felt much better in an instant. "In the heart of the headmaster, he still knows that I am better than Junior Brother Yuan."
Kang Dabao finally turned his attention to Jiang Qing. There were actually no exceptionally talented people among the next generation of disciples. The hope for the sect's revival would ultimately rest on this "Sword Immortal" of the Chongming Sect.
"When we are done, take all the treasures out of the coffin and give them to the third brother for safekeeping."
Just as Sect Leader Kang was thinking this, he saw Yuan Jin, who was no longer as sloppy as usual, walked out with red eyes, and immediately bowed down in the hall.
"It is not easy to restore the sect. I am an unworthy disciple. In the past, the sect leader relied on me alone to run the sect. I still remember the hardships I went through. Today, I am worried about you again, but I am powerless. I hope you take care of yourself and don't get hurt!"
"Disciple Chongming, thanks the master!" Pei Yi, the elder who taught the skills, immediately stepped out and sang loudly.
"Disciple Chongming, thanks the master!" Everyone in the hall stood up and bowed together when they heard the voice.
"I am unworthy of this. The revival of our sect depends on you all!" Sect Master Kang laughed through his tears and bowed deeply to the leader.
